"Migration" is the repeated movement back and forth of a population. = This new phrase "assisted migration", in contrast, seems to apply to = human assistance in dispersal/range extension, to compensate for climate = change.
Clearly the term is already spawning confusion. I suggest we banish it = in its infancy, and use a term such as "assisted dispersal", "species = translocation", or something that accurately describes the idea. Dave Whitacre
